  "details" : [ "The fuse_direct_io function in fs/fuse/file.c in the fuse subsystem in the Linux kernel before 2.6.32-rc7 might allow attackers to cause a denial of service (invalid pointer dereference and OOPS) via vectors possibly related to a memory-consumption attack." ],
  "statement" : "Red Hat is aware of this issue and is tracking it via the following bug: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/CVE-2009-4021\nThe Linux kernel packages as sh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 3 and 4 do not include support for FUSE, and therefore are not affected by this issue.\nA future kernel update for Red Hat Enterprise MRG will address this flaw.",
